Output f927926b3604b1cee33e94955ffccf6af9e3a7fc9f1fd0bf8aca9be687155909:22

value
515664
script pubkey
OP_0 OP_PUSHBYTES_20 3d57b704c4fcdbc2e19bc2164237f00f633af5cc
address
bc1q84tmwpxylndu9cvmcgtyydlspa3n4awvwvvfgw
transaction
f927926b3604b1cee33e94955ffccf6af9e3a7fc9f1fd0bf8aca9be687155909
spent
true